libgpac
Documentation of the core library of GPAC
Loading...
Searching...
No Matches
evg.idl File Reference

Data Structures

interface  Canvas
interface  IRect
interface  Rect
interface  Point2D
interface  AlphaCallback
interface  Path
interface  PenSettings
interface  Matrix2D
interface  ColorMatrix
interface  Color
interface  Colorf
interface  Stencil
interface  Texture
interface  ConvolutionKernel
interface  Text
interface  TextMeasure
interface  Matrix
interface  Vec3f
interface  Rectf
interface  Vec4f
interface  VertexAttribInterpolator
interface  VertexAttrib
interface  BlitParameters
interface  Mesh

Enumerations

enum  ShaderType { GF_EVG_SHADER_FRAGMENT =1 , GF_EVG_SHADER_VERTEX }
enum  AttributeMapType { GF_EVG_VAI_VERTEX_INDEX =0 , GF_EVG_VAI_VERTEX , GF_EVG_VAI_PRIMITIVE }

Functions

void push ()
long push (DOMString left_val, DOMString operand, DOMString right_val, optional DOMString right_val2=null)
long push (DOMString cond_val, DOMString left_val, DOMString operand, DOMString right_val)
long push (DOMString end_cond_val)
long push (DOMString goto_val, long stack_index)
long push (DOMString goto_val, DOMString stack_index_uniform)
void update ()
long PixelSize (DOMString pixel_format)